CVE-2024-37943: WordPress YITH WooCommerce Ajax Product Filter plugin <= 5.1.0 - Reflected Cross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ability
Improper Neutralization of Input During Web Page Generation ('Cross-site Scripting') vulnerability in YITHEMES YITH WooCommerce Ajax Product Filter yith-woocommerce-ajax-navigation.This issue affects YITH WooCommerce Ajax Product Filter: from n/a through <= 5.1.0.

What is the severity of CVE-2024-37943?
CVE-2024-37943 is classified as a high-severity reflected c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ability.
How do I fix CVE-2024-37943?
To fix CVE-2024-37943, upgrade the YITH WooCommerce Ajax Product Filter plugin to version 5.1.1 or later.
What is the impact of CVE-2024-37943?
The impact of CVE-2024-37943 allows attackers to execute arbitrary scripts in the context of the user’s session, potentially leading to data theft or session hijacking.
Which versions of YITH WooCommerce Ajax Product Filter are affected by CVE-2024-37943?
CVE-2024-37943 affects all versions of YITH WooCommerce Ajax Product Filter up to and including version 5.1.0.
Is user input involved in CVE-2024-37943?
Yes, CVE-2024-37943 involves improper neutralization of user input during web page generation, leading to XSS.
